Robert Earl Jones was born on 3 February 1910 in Senatobia, Mississippi, USA. He was an actor, known for The Sting (1973), Sleepaway Camp (1983) and Witness (1985). He was married to Ruth Connolly, Jumelle P. Jones and Ruth Williams. He died on 7 September 2006 in Englewood, New Jersey, USA.

Robert Earl Jones was an American actor and professional boxer. Better known as “Earl Jones,” he is remembered as one of the first prominent actors of African–American origin and a legend from the Harlem Renaissance of the 1920s and the 1930s.
